Physical and Chemical Properties

Top
Molecular Formula C18H24O5
Molecular Weight 320.40 g/mol
Exact Mass 320.16237386 g/mol
Topological Polar Surface Area (TPSA) 76.10 Ų
XlogP 1.60
Atomic LogP (AlogP) 2.23
H-Bond Acceptor 5
H-Bond Donor 1
Rotatable Bonds 7
